Disability shower installation services involve adapting or constructing show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of walk-in or curbless showers,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and accessible seating options. The goal is to create a safe, functional, and comfortable bathing environment that meets the specific needs of users with limited mobility, ensuring they can maintain independence and safety during daily routines.
These installations address common problems such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ds, risk of slips and falls, and limited access to traditional shower setups. By modifying existing bathrooms or constructing new accessible showers, these services help reduce the hazards associated with standard shower designs. They also provide convenience for caregivers and family members, making bathing routines easier and safer for everyone involved.
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services include residential homes, especially those with elderly residents or individuals with disabilities. Additionally, assisted living facilities, nursing homes, and healthcare centers often seek these modifications to meet accessibility standards and improve resident safety. Commercial properties that serve individuals with mobility challenges, such as community centers or public restrooms, may also require accessible shower installations.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in New Bloomfield,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000. Factors influencing the price include shower size, accessibility features, and existing plumbing.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Material costs for disability shower installations usually fall between $500 and $2,500. Choices such as custom tiles, grab bars, and walk-in designs can impact overall expenses.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ing a disability shower generally range from $800 to $2,500. The complexity of the installation and local labor rates are key factors affecting costs.
Additional Features - Adding features like non-slip flooring or specialized seating can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. Local service providers can advise on options to enhance accessibility within budget.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
